The Psychology Department invites you to explore our rich and diverse curriculum. Our Bachelor of Science in Psychology major offers two concentrations: Psychology and Psychology: Paralegal Studies. Our department also offers two 18-credit minors: Psychology and Multicultural Studies in the United States. Psychology explores multiple areas of study such as; law, medicine, chemistry, biology, and social sciences; while understanding and serving human needs. 

Our Psychology major offers two undergraduate B.S. degree concentrations, each consisting of 120 credits: B.S. Psychology or Psychology: Paralegal Studies. These concentrations help to prepare students better for subfields within psychology, giving students the opportunity to explore various fields in their area of study. Students in any concentration can later pursue careers or apply to graduate school within any field of psychology. Accordingly, the selection of a concentration should depend upon interests, career goals, and graduation target date. 

We have a diverse faculty who provide students with opportunities to gain experience via internships and research opportunities. Our department facilities include computer labs for teaching statistics and research methods, a student lounge (OM 383-B) and specialized research labs in visual perception, cognition and biofeedback.
